Overview
- The Department for Work and Pensions advanced payments scheduled for Monday, May 26, to Friday, May 23, to account for the Spring Bank Holiday closure.
- This adjustment impacted multiple benefits, including Universal Credit, state pensions, PIP, and Carer's Allowance, ensuring claimants received funds before the holiday weekend.
- Universal Credit recipients under 25 received £316.98, while those over 25 received £400.14, reflecting the 1.7% uprating applied in April.
- State pensioners born after 1953 received early payments of £921, in line with the 4.1% uprating introduced in April.
- DWP offices and helplines are closed until May 27, and claimants were urged to verify payments by May 23 to address any issues before the extended closure.
